Q: Who approves new event schemas before a release? A: The Brindlewharf schema registry blocks deploys on incompatible changes. Register the schema, run the compatibility check, and get a sign-off from the owning team. No manual overrides without an incident ticket. The registration steps and compatibility matrix are on the page below.

operations page: https://jenkins.zemvarcloud.local/job/merge_requests/repo/build/73930b4b30f0a8ed

**CI note: Spoolhaven service flaking again.** If your plugin tests hang on the print-queue mock, it's the spooler microservice taking too long to warm up — bump the readiness timeout to 30s and you're fine. Don't retry blindly; it masks real failures. The last known-good build token is below.

build token for tawip-yageg: htk9_92ac43d42

## BranchSweep 2.1 — Default Changes

Heads up for new contractors: BranchSweep now archives stale branches after 60 days instead of 90, and protected-branch patterns are matched case-insensitively. Dry-run mode is off by default on internal repos. Notifications go to branch authors two weeks before archival. Current defaults are listed below.

settings of bawif-fawif:
ralix:
  log_level: warn
  metrics_host: metrics.ralix.tolvaqsys.internal
  pool_size: 32

# Catalog cache invalidation — read this before you touch anything.
# Shelfwise busts product cache entries via pub/sub events, not TTLs,
# so if prices look stale, check the invalidation worker first.
# Don't be tempted to crank the TTL down; it hammers the catalog DB.
# The worker authenticates to the event bus with the credential set on the next line:

sealed setting: ARCHIVE_KEY3=8d0